Output 895eafbc43b2cb2e0ff69e9d68bb7345e91c189e46e8c4fc5e89be1e2dd24ec3:0

value
8148600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c23af1a922f8738f26a2b54a231387e51edcc25b OP_EQUAL
address
3KQ1dFy7Re2T6eUwjM1cvWuhsi5JqD4ad7
transaction
895eafbc43b2cb2e0ff69e9d68bb7345e91c189e46e8c4fc5e89be1e2dd24ec3
spent
true